Birth Injury
Children who have cerebral palsy may receive therapy, medication, and surgery to improve their quality of life. However, they'll require assistance from their families throughout their lives. Cerebral Palsy can be caused by a birth defect medical negligence or a brain injury during delivery. A lawyer can help families in seeking financial compensation for the CP treatment of their child.
Attorneys at a firm who handle birth injuries are able to investigate each case to determine whether any healthcare providers have committed wrongdoing. They interview witnesses and review medical records including fetal monitoring strips, head images tests, and other evidence like photographs and prenatal records. The attorneys will be able to determine if the delivery was rushed and whether the child required forceps or vacuum extraction, as well as other factors.
The lawyers determine the settlement amount considering all the tangible and intangible loss that the family has suffered since the child's diagnosis. This includes the cost of mobility aids, medications, assistive devices, special education, surgeries and transportation equipment, as well as occupational, physical, and speech therapy. The lawyers also seek compensation for the emotional, physical, and financial stress caused due to the child's medical condition. They can also file a lawsuit in order to obtain a fair financial award during an investigation.

Statute of limitations
If a medical provider causes an injury that causes a birth defect such as cerebral palsy, the patient may file a medical malpractice lawsuit against them. These lawsuits seek compensation for the medical expenses incurred by the child in the past and in the future and any other expenses.
A family must act swiftly when it is time to make a claim. Each state has its own statute of limitations that defines the date by which a lawsuit can be filed. When the time limit is up the potential plaintiff is no longer entitled to file a lawsuit against the medical professionals who are responsible for their child's injuries.
A cerebral palsy lawyer can assist you in filing a claim before the statute of limitations expires. In addition legal counsel can help the family gather evidence to demonstrate that their child's disability was due to medical negligence.
Following the initial medical legal review, a cerebral-palsy attorney will write an official demand letter, requesting the defendants to pay the victims. They will then conduct additional research and gather additional evidence that the injury was the result of an error in medicine.
